Modern ministry

It was founded on 5 February 1992. The official flag of the Ministry of Defense was established by Presidential Decree on 17 June 2014.


Functions

The Ministry of Defense is currently responsible for carrying out the following duties: * Organization and control of the Moldovan National Army * Representing the armed forces in the cabinet * Reporting to the Government of Moldova on military affairs * Executing the military policy of the government and the
President of Moldova The President of the Republic of Moldova () is the head of state of Moldova. The current president is Maia Sandu, who assumed office on 24 December 2020. Duties and functions The office of the presidency in Moldova is largely ceremonial, ...
* Management of all military related activities and military operations * Oversight of military construction * Development of communication and transport systems * Provision of military storage * Management of military offices and institutions * Administration of military academies * Welfare of retired military personnel * Equipping the armed forces with necessary technology * Corresponding with foreign defence ministries
